Quick verdict

For most buyers the Avalon A1466 is the stronger pick — it leads on 3 of 4 head-to-head factors. The Avalon A1446 runs 135.0 TH/s at 24.5 J/TH; the Avalon A1466 runs 150.0 TH/s at 21.5 J/TH.

Spec Deltas

Here is every spec where the Avalon A1446 and Avalon A1466 actually differ, with the gap quantified:

  • Avalon A1466 11% more hashrate (135 vs 150 TH/s)
  • Avalon A1466 2% better power draw (3,310 vs 3,230 W)
  • Avalon A1466 12% better efficacité (24.5 vs 21.5 J/TH)
  • Avalon A1446 2% more heat output (11,294 vs 11,021 BTU/hr)

Avalon A1446 vs Avalon A1466: how much does the efficiency gap matter?

The Avalon A1446 runs at 24.5 J/TH while the Avalon A1466 runs at 21.5 J/TH — a difference of 3.0 J/TH. Lower efficiency means less electricity per terahash of mining power, directly reducing operating costs. In relative terms that is 12% better efficacité (24.5 vs 21.5 J/TH).
